Default boosted d16y8 running lean after 4.5k?? why?

just dynoed my buddies d16y8 sohc vtec today, and that ---- leaned out big time after around vtec too like 14.1-15.3 after 5k..I'm using 440 rc's with apexi safc, I ricjin it as much as i could up top but it still leans out. Almost feels like it didn't make any corrections after vtec. from 1-4k fuel is good, I'm coming too the conclusion is it possibly cause' i'm using s-afc rather than vafc? not having the option of controlling hi-cam? i dunno it's wierd help me out guys. If any of you are using 440's or 450's with s-afc on vtec motors and having problems leaning out around 4.5-7k let me know.
